Ball Arena is the site where the Colorado Avalanche (49-29-4) will take on the Dallas Stars (50-26-6) on Wednesday in Game 3 of the Western Conference first round. The series is tied up at 1-1. The odds on this game have Dallas at -122 and Colorado opens at +102. The over/under is set at 6.

The Dallas Stars came out of Game 2 feeling pretty good about themselves with a 4-3 win over the Avalanche. The Stars had a solid offensive output and it showed in the victory. In the game, they converted 4 out of the 39 shots they attempted. They also had 4 power play tries and were able to notch 1 goal. Dallas had 6 minutes in the box in this matchup.

With respect to scoring goals, the Dallas Stars have accounted for 275 goals (4th in the league) this season and have surrendered 222. For the season, they have accumulated 106 points and their points percentage sits at .646. Dallas skates onto the rink with 250 power play chances and they have scored 55 goals out of those tries, giving them a rate of 22.00%. When at even strength, the Stars have conceded 181 goals while scoring 220 as an offensive unit. Dallas has taken 2,325 shots and is the owner of a shooting percentage of 11.8%. The Stars have had 2,382 shots tried against them and have a save percentage of .907. Dallas Stars opponents have earned 228 power play opportunities (15th in pro hockey) and have come away with 41 goals in those chances.

The man protecting the net in this game is Jake Oettinger. For his professional hockey career, Oettinger has compiled 142 quality starts and his quality starts percentage is .587. He has a save percentage of .912 during his 11,183 minutes guarding the cage. Oettinger has seen 6,904 shots taken against him and has amassed 6,296 total saves. Opponents have notched 608 goals against Oettinger in his NHL career and his goals against average is 3.26. He has amassed a mark of 149-66-27 and he was named the starter in 242 games. Oettinger has been involved in 251 matchups during his pro hockey career.
In Game 2 Colorado had 3 chances on the power play in this outing and scored 1 out of those tries. The Avalanche scored 3 goals of the 37 shots on goal they tried.
On the season, the Colorado Avalanche have 273 goals, 102 points, as well as a points percentage of .622. They have permitted 231 goals to be scored by way of 189 goals at even strength and 42 goals while they were shorthanded. The Avalanche are sitting with 215 goals at even strength and 58 goals (6th in the league) while on the power play. They have a tally of 234 power play chances and they have accumulated a power play rate of 24.79%. Colorado has attempted 2,451 shots (5th in the league) and has earned a shooting percentage of 11.14%, while allowing their opponents 2,126 shots. They have accumulated a penalty kill percentage of 79.81% on their oppositions 208 power play opportunities, and their save percentage is 89.1%.
Across the rink you are going to see Mackenzie Blackwood protecting the net. He has accounted for 6,727 saves out of the 7,428 shots tried, giving him a rate of .906. Blackwood is sitting with a career mark of 103-103-28 and has been in goal for 252 games. He has started in 237 games and has racked up 11,134 mins. Blackwood's quality start percentage comes out to 55.7% and he has made 132 quality starts in his pro career. Opponents are averaging 3.78 goals per game and he has surrendered 701 goals overall.
